LEVEQUE, Appellant, v. ABBOTT LABORATORIES, et al., Respondents.

The above entitled cause is transferred to the Court of Appeal, First Appellate District, Division Five, for reconsideration in light of Jolly v. Eli Lilly & Co. (1988) 44 Cal.3d 1103, 245 Cal.Rptr. 658, 751 P.2d 923.
